Foros del Web » Programación para mayores de 30 ;) » .NET »

Manejar Tabcontrol c# winforms

Estas en el tema de Manejar Tabcontrol c# winforms en el foro de .NET en Foros del Web. Hola. Gracias de antemano por la ayuda que dais en este foro,sobre todo para la gente que no tenemos mucha experiencia. Os cuento mi problema.Tengo ...
  #1 (permalink)  
Antiguo 31/08/2016, 23:54
 
Fecha de Ingreso: abril-2012
Mensajes: 42
Antigüedad: 12 años, 8 meses
Puntos: 0
Manejar Tabcontrol c# winforms

Hola. Gracias de antemano por la ayuda que dais en este foro,sobre todo para la gente que no tenemos mucha experiencia. Os cuento mi problema.Tengo un TabControl(estoy trabajando con c# y Winforms), y un boton de crear. Inicialmente, solo tiene una pestaña(para introducir direcciones) con una serie de campos (cajas de texto,combos) que se cargan al iniciar el formulario a través de una dll. Cuando doi al boton de crear,los datos que se han rellenado se graban en bbdd, y se crea una nueva pestaña con el formulario de campos vacios para que pueda rellenar el usuario otra direccion. El problema surge que cuando doi al boton crear, me coge los campos de la primera pestaña y no los de la segunda que es los que acabo de rellenar. Entiendo que debe haber alguna manera de que coja los datos de la pestaña activa pero no se como realizarlo.
Gracias
  #2 (permalink)  
Antiguo 14/09/2016, 19:22
 
Fecha de Ingreso: noviembre-2002
Ubicación: DF
Mensajes: 1.056
Antigüedad: 22 años, 1 mes
Puntos: 37
Respuesta: Manejar Tabcontrol c# winforms

Imagino que es por que estas accesando directo con el nombre de los controles textbox de la 1a pestaña.
Los nuevos creados se deben estar creando con otro nombre, uno aleatorio seguramente si es que no les estas seteando la propiedad ".name" al control recien creado.

Etiquetas: dato, form, manejar, pestaña, tabcontrol
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:17.